非常风气网www.verywind.cn
首页
c语言随机字符串
如何用
C语言
,从键盘输入一个
字符串
,将其按逆序存入另一个字符数组中并...
答:
以一个8为
字符串
为例:代码如下 include<stdio.h> int main(){ int i,j;char ch1[8],ch2[8];for(i=0;i<8;i++){ printf("请输入第%d个字符",i);scanf("%
c
",&ch1[i]);fflush(stdin);} for(j=0;j<8;j++){ ch2[j]=ch1[7-j];printf("%c",ch2[j]);} } ...
C语言
,
字符串
指针指向的字符串,那个字符串存储在哪个位置?
答:
动态
随机
分配内存空间,共6个char型数据大小的空间,因为是随机的,idxbuf指针指向的内存空间的起始地址在后面的语句中打印出来:printf("before idxbuf address:%p,idxbuf:%s\n\n",&idxbuf,&idxbuf:取地址,%p与指针对应,是输出指针的地址。address:0x7ffeffc9f0b0,就是
字符串
指针idxbuf指向的...
c语言
如何查找
字符串
?
答:
C语言
中的标准函数库中的strchr()函数可以实现查找
字符串
中的某个字符。C语言strchr()函数:查找某字符在字符串中首次出现的位置 头文件:#include <string.h> strchr() 用来查找某字符在字符串中首次出现的位置,其原型为:char * strchr (const char *str, int c);【参数】str 为要查找的字符...
C语言
题目:提取一个
字符串
中的所有数字字符(‘0’...‘9’)将其转换为...
答:
include<stdio.h>#include<string.h>int main(){ char s[20]; int i; printf("输入包含数字的
字符串
:"); scanf("%s",s); printf("其中整型数字位为:"); for(i=0;i<strlen(s);i++) { if(s[i]>=48 && s[i]<=57) { printf("%d",(int)s[...
一些有关
C语言
中实用且很牛的技能!
答:
现在,假设我们想为每个错误码提供一个错误描述的
字符串
。为了确保数组保持了最新的定义,无论头文件做了任何修改或增补,我们都可以用这个数组指定的语法。 这样就可以静态分配足够的空间,且保证最大的索引是合法的,同时将特殊的索引初始化为指定的值,并将剩下的索引初始化为0。 三、结构体与联合体 用结构体与联合...
C语言
中string指令是什么?
答:
at() 按给定索引值返回字符 begin() 返回一个迭代器,指向第一个字符
c
_str() 将
字符串
以
C字符
数组的形式返回 capacity() 返回重新分配空间前的字符容量 compare() 比较两个字符串 copy() 将内容复制为一个字符数组 data() 返回内容的字符数组形式 empty() 如果字符串为空,返回真 end() 返回...
C语言
中给定一个
字符串
,判断它是否包括字母和数字
答:
1 定义两个flag,用来标记是否含有字母和数字,初始值为0;2 输入
字符串
;3 遍历字符串,如果发现字母,标记字母flag,如果发现数字,标记数字flag;4 遍历结束,或者两个flag均被标记,退出循环;5 输出结果。代码如下:int main(){ char s[100]; int
c
,n, i; c = n = 0; get...
C语言字符串
排序
答:
include <malloc.h> define MAX 10 void stsrt(char *str[],int num);void ASC(char *str[],int num);void length_add(char *str[],int num);void word_length(char *str[],int num);int main(void) { char *s[MAX],t[80];int i = 0,n;printf("输入%d个
字符串
:\n",MAX)...
c语言
空
字符
?
答:
你问的这个符号叫结束符号,要加。0是
字符串
的结束符号。内部函数识别字符串都是以0为结束位置。否则会从数组起始地址一直找,直到越界。除非你的字符数组变量是静态变量或者是全局变量。否则字符数组没有初值,默认是
随机
数。如所有数组元素给初值0(或不完全赋值0,这种情况缺省的自动取0)。这样才不...
C语言
里有
字符
变量正确吗
答:
错误的,
C语言
中只有
字符串
常量而没有字符串变量。字符串比较大小是以第1个不相同字符的大小为标准的,跟长度没有关系。字符串比较大小除了使用库函数stremp(以外,就只能靠自己写代码来实现了,而不能通过关系运算符来比较大小,因为字符串在表达式中相当于coostchar*,即常字符指针,代表的是字符串的首...
<涓婁竴椤
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
你可能感兴趣的内容
c语言字符串拼接
c语言字符串长度怎么算
随机字符串
随机产生字符串
本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
©
非常风气网